- ベストアンサー
※ ChatGPTを利用し、要約された質問です(原文:日本語ファイル名のFTPについて)
日本語ファイル名のFTPで文字化け対策は?
このQ&Aのポイント
- 日本語ファイル名のFTPを行っている際、ファイル名が文字化けして困っています。解決策をご存知の方がいらっしゃいましたら、教えてください。
- FTPを行う際には、文字コードと転送モードを指定する必要があります。また、サーバの文字コードも確認してください。
- ご教授の程よろしくお願いいたします。
- みんなの回答 (2)
- 専門家の回答
質問者が選んだベストアンサー
確認する環境がないので すごくてきとーに言ってしまうこと 最初に謝るわね。 JavaのソースをUTF-8で書いてみるとか 実行オプションでUTF-8指定してみるとかどうかしら。 それと文字化けは具体的にどんな文字に? もしかして復元可能だったりしないかなと。 いっそのこと 取得後名前を変えればいいんじゃないかしら と思ってみる。
その他の回答 (1)
- himajin100000
- ベストアンサー率54% (1660/3060)
回答No.2
俺も確認環境がないのに無根拠に言ってみる。 *自分ので動作させてみる *正常に動作するFTPクライアントで実験してみる *上記二つでネットワーク上を流れるデータをWireSharkなどで確認。バイト列に差があるか見る、とか自分はやってみると思う。(ネットワーク上流れるデータ同じなら結果おなじになるだろって) **例えば、実はsetControlEncodingを呼ぶ、connectの前でなければならないとか…
お礼
ご意見ありがとうございます。 文字化けは、日本語部分が「?(半角)」になってしまっています。 例)53ああああ.dat ⇒ 53????.dat とりあえず実行オプションでUTF-8指定ってのを試してみます。 お忙しい中、ありがとうございました。m(_ _)m